Pancreatic cancer is a silent killer, watch for these symptoms


If you lose too much weight. So there may be symptoms of pancreatic cancer. You need to pay attention to it.

Stomach or back pain: This pain may occur in the upper stomach or mid or upper back. This pain comes and goes and can be worse when lying down.

Jaundice: This is a common symptom. In this case, the white part of the skin or eyes turns yellow. Due to jaundice, the color of urine may become dark and the color of stool may become yellow.

Weight loss: Pancreatic cancer can cause weight loss.

Stool changes: Pancreatic cancer can cause a change in stools. Stools may be loose, watery, oily and smelly.

Symptoms of pancreatic cancer include nausea, bloating, fatigue, jaundice and loss of appetite.
